Understanding Clear Braces Technology

Clear braces utilize materials and designs intended to blend with natural teeth while applying controlled forces to guide tooth movement. The technology behind these appliances focuses on balancing aesthetics with functional efficiency. Different brands may offer variations in materials, bracket design, and bonding techniques that influence comfort and effectiveness throughout the treatment process.

Material Composition and Durability

The materials used in clear braces are selected for their translucency and strength. Some brands prioritize ceramics or composite substances engineered to resist staining over time while maintaining structural integrity. Durability is a key consideration as it impacts the longevity of the appliance during treatment, reducing the need for repairs or replacements.

Comfort and Aesthetic Appeal

Patient experience during orthodontic care is influenced by factors such as bracket size, profile height, and how well the appliance integrates visually with natural teeth. Brands vary in their focus on minimizing discomfort caused by friction or irritation while optimizing aesthetic appeal through subtle color matching or reduced visibility techniques.
